Sleigh Bells Surprise Single

Bitter Rivals, Sleigh Bells third album dropped in 2013 and we fell in love with “Rill Rill”… Its been almost 3 years and the next hit we’ve been craving is here, the dynamic duo that makes up this indie roc band has just released their newest single “Champions of Unrestricted Beauty”.  A little different from the last album, this song comes with more subdued vocals and a calmer toner.  Either way, we still love it, and even better the full fourth album will be released via Twitter come 2016.


via Soundcloud

Leave a comment